Eric Menyuk (born 5 November 1959; age 64) is the actor who portrayed the recurring part of the Traveler in the Star Trek: The Next Generation episodes "Where No One Has Gone Before", "Remember Me", and "Journey's End". Menyuk originally auditioned for the role of Data, only to be beaten out by Brent Spiner. His costume from the episode "Remember Me" was later sold off on the web. [1]

He also guest starred in Cheers, Married... with Children (with Gene LeBell) and Matlock. He also had a supporting role in the fantasy comedy Ghost Dad (1990, with Dakin Matthews, Jeanne Mori, and Ivonne Perez).

His appearances in law-oriented television series such as Hill Street Blues, Night Court (with John Larroquette), Matlock, and Diagnosis: Murder were perhaps predictive, as Menyuk is now an attorney.
